Best Time to Bring Your Child In
Timing is everything when it comes to a successful first haircut. We recommend scheduling your child’s appointment during:
Early Morning: Kids are typically well-rested and in the best mood.
Playtime Hours: When they’re naturally active and engaged, making them less likely to feel fussy or overwhelmed.
Avoid booking before or directly after nap times or mealtimes, as a sleepy or hungry child may be more irritable and have a harder time sitting still.
Bring Comfort Items
A familiar toy, snack, or even a tablet with their favorite show can work wonders in keeping your child occupied and comfortable. These small comforts help create a sense of security, making the experience feel less intimidating.
Comb Out Knots Before the Appointment
One of the best ways to prevent discomfort is to gently detangle your child’s hair before the appointment. Knots and tangles can make the haircut process uncomfortable, so taking a few minutes to comb through their hair at home ensures a smoother and pain-free experience.
